The question concerning technology and romanticism -- Romanticism -- Romanticism against the machine -- Romanticism with the machine -- Romanticism with the machine (1) : from Frankenstein's monster to hippie computing -- Romanticism with the machine (2) : cyber romanticism, uncanny robots, romantic cyborgs, and spooky science -- Beyond romanticism, beyond the machine -- Criticisms of romanticism and of the end of the machine -- Beyond romanticism and beyond modernity : towards the (real) end of the machine.
